    The intriguing study titled "Optimizing irradiation dose for Drosophila melanogaster males to enhance heterospecific Sterile Insect Technique (h-SIT) against Drosophila suzukii" dives deep into how researchers are perfecting methods to control this pesky fly using sterile insect techniques (SIT). Essentially, they tweak the irradiation doses to sterilize male flies so that when they mate with wild females, no offspring are produced—an eco-friendly pest control marvel.
